For centuries, chandeliers have served as a hallmark of opulence in magnificent halls and upscale residences. Their elaborate craftsmanship and radiant glow are emblems of wealth, authority, and sophistication. Beyond their aesthetic charm, these magnificent light fixtures convey deep meanings related to social standing and closeness.

Historically, chandeliers were exclusive to the elite, embodying their elevated social class and dominance. The most extravagant chandeliers graced palaces and magnificent estates, highlighting the luxurious lifestyle of the aristocracy. The dimensions and artistry of these fixtures were statements of affluence, with the most grandiose designs reserved for the social elite.

Additionally, chandeliers were central to intimate gatherings and celebrations. Often serving as the focal point during banquets and balls, they cast a cozy and welcoming light over the festivities. In this setting, a chandelier not only illuminated the occasion but also fostered a sense of togetherness and shared joy under its warm glow.

As time evolved, chandeliers became more within reach for the wider population, yet their profound symbolism persisted. In contemporary society, these lighting solutions are still linked to grandeur and elegance, frequently adorning luxury hotels, upscale restaurants, and theaters. They also maintain their role in creating a cozy atmosphere, often featured in weddings and significant events that unite people in celebration.
